我可以在远程机器上构建和调试c ++程序吗?

时间:2010-04-16 09:06:39

标签: c++ eclipse build debugging

我在Windows XP上想要在linux远程pc上构建程序 我已经在远程机器上安装了Ganymede,CDT,RSE ......但是如何配置这一切呢? 我做得对吗?任何人都可以建议

2 个答案:

答案 0 :(得分:0)

您可以使用VNC或类似的远程桌面基础架构访问您的远程计算机。这将允许您像在本地计算机中一样使用Eclipse(编辑,构建,运行,调试等)。

如果带宽太窄或者你没有管理Linux盒子,你可以通过SSH或telnet访问并在控制台模式下工作(使用Emacs / Vim,gdb和所有这些东西)。

答案 1 :(得分:0)

查看https://github.com/ericwoodruff/rmake您将配置IDE并在本地编辑代码,但它使用rsync在远程计算机上构建。我在惠普使用它在多个平台上构建C ++程序,linux-> windows,windows-> linux。它在命令行中工作,我也使用了eclipse构建器来调用它。如果启用--no-decorate,Eclipse甚至可以将构建输出解析为问题视图。